You don't win the Verbier Extreme five times and ride any old board. The Arbor Steepwater Snowboard was built in collaboration with Steve Klassen, big mountain snowboard pioneer. The Steepwater is built for power and control at speed on steep, exposed terrain. The full camber profile supplies you with the edging and pop you demand in gnargnar situations, while the directional shape is stable when rocketing out the bottom.
Full Camber – A modern version of the classic camber that many riders grew up with. Like the classic, it offers more stability and grip because more of your board is in the snow when it’s set on edge. Unlike the classic version, this profile offers more float and speed in soft snow thanks to a smoother transition into the nose area.
Stiff Flex – Performance at speed and through variable, big mountain terrain. Expect Ferrari like acceleration and control.
Directional – A slight stance setback combined with a directional shape provides you with a surfy ride in deep snow. Directional boards also give riders ample control and stability when dropping through chutes or landing big airs at high-speeds.
Blended Paulownia-Poplar Wood – Lighter weight durability
Triax Glassing – A stiffer lay-up for high-load, on-edge performance
Power Ply Top – Structural, performance enhancing real wood. Protective film laminated to the power ply tops contains 30% bio-plastic and eliminates the need for toxic clear coats.
Ply [topsheet] – Premium burled eucalyptus
360-Degree Full Wrap Sidewalls – Durability and impact resistance
Extruded Base – Polyethylene pellets are melted down in extreme heat then forced together under a high pressure machine. The end result is a strong, solid, and smooth base that is easy to maintain, non-porous and extremely durable.

This one goes out to the all-mountain riders looking for a rear-entry binding that is both playful and responsive. The Flow NX2 Snowboard Bindings are here to take your riding to new heights. The GF-Nylon Modback offers up a medium flex, perfect for exploring the whole mountain from peak to park. With Flow's traditional Fusion PowerStrap you'll have to confidence to charge faster and send it bigger thanks to the fused ankle and toe zones. Response and power have never been this easy thanks to the Flow NX2 Snowboard Bindings.
Attitude and Terrain – Flow bindings are designed with an idea or direction as to where they will perform best. Every binding has a different feel and terrain type associated to it, allowing you to make a decision based on your preferred terrain and riding style.
Aluminum Alloy Rockered Baseplate – Engineered to transmit energy directly to the board without loss of efficiency. The minimized contact area with the board channels your power where it needs to go while the rockered corners of the baseplate allow any type of board to maintain optimal flex.
BankBeds with OC-Kush Impact Inserts – BankBeds are full-length EVA-footbeds with 2.5 degree canting for optimized fit, support and energy transfer. Featured on the NX2, Fuse, and ISIS series.
Glass Filled Nylon ModBack – The modular hibacks separate the lower and upper zones for targeted strength, support, and flex where you need it. The GF-Nylon Mod-Backs offer a lively and fun feel.
Fusion PowerStrap – Features a 3D shaped strap that fuses the ankle and toe zones together over the midfoot. Padded for a super comfortable form-fit to your boot. The Fusion PowerStrap provides maximum support and energy transmission.
Active Strap Technology – SpeedEntry has never been more convenient without sacrificing the superior performance, comfort and power transmission that Flow bindings are famous for. With their revolutionary New Active Strap Technology (N.A.S.T.Y.), the strap automatically lifts you up when you open the reclining hiback and actively tightens again when you close the hiback. N.A.S.T.Y. reduces friction and creates more room so that getting in and out of your binding is faster and easier than ever.
LSR Buckles – These innovative LockingSlapRatchet buckles give you the option to easily get in and out of your bindings any which way you like, whether SpeedEntry or DualEntry.
